If you wait for the t-stat to open up and feel both upper and lower hoses, they should be close in temp. Touching the fins of the radiator themselves will be fairly inconsistent.
If you have noticed your gauge getting hotter, then you might have blockage restricting flow. Green coolant is 3yr/36kmi while others go up to 5yr/100kmi but coolant does break down and gain corrosive properties after a while.
